NI lost all appeal it used to have. Go elsewhere. - Avis employé Hardware Engineer National Instruments

Avantages

Slow paced, allows for some flexibility.

Inconvénients

Pay. They were known to pay less but have stability and great work life balance. After the acquisition, all their top performing employees left because they have layoffs every 3-4 months consistently since the closing of the acquisition. Less people means more work on the employees still there, salary is still much lower compared to the industry average. PTO and other benefits have also lowered since. People were happy to take the lower pay cut for the lifestyle offered here, but now you are paid less than everyone else for the same if not more work. No longer worth it.
